利用反射实现更通用的调用 当需要调用带有不同参数签名的函数时,可以借助reflect包实现更通用的动态调用。
cPanel环境通常有多个PHP版本,需要确保选择与Laravel项目兼容的版本。
要使用 SonarQube 分析 .NET 微服务的代码质量,核心步骤包括环境准备、项目配置、代码扫描和结果查看。
本文介绍了如何在使用 io.CopyN 函数进行数据拷贝时,优雅地中断拷贝操作。
我个人在Windows上遇到过好几次,总是忘记把MinGW的bin目录加到PATH里,每次都要重新设置一下。
避免COUNT(*): COUNT(*) 在数据量大的时候会很慢,可以考虑使用近似值或者预先计算好的总数。
如果你要做企业后台、电商平台或需要快速迭代的项目,它很合适。
这时,XQuery Full Text (XQFT) 扩展就派上用场了。
比如 example.com/search.php?query=php&page=1。
使用f-string构建SQL语句时,要特别注意SQL注入风险。
立即学习“PHP免费学习笔记(深入)”; index.php 这个文件非常简单,只输出一个字符串。
为了便于后续的独立处理、存储或分发,将这些json数组中的每个对象拆分成单独的json文件是一个常见的需求。
接着,关键一步是确保这些日志都输出到标准输出(stdout)或标准错误(stderr)。
1. 问题背景与错误分析 在将python flask应用与sqlite数据库一同部署到docker容器时,开发者常会遇到sqlite3.operationalerror: unable to open database file错误。
示例:调用 IronPython 脚本中的类 ScriptEngine engine = Python.CreateEngine(); dynamic result = engine.Execute(@" class Calculator: def add(self, a, b): return a + b Calculator() "); int sum = result.add(3, 5); // 运行时解析 add 方法 这里 result 是一个 Python 对象包装器,C# 编译器无法知道它有 add 方法,但通过 dynamic 可在运行时成功调用。
双击打开或直接在浏览器中加载.php文件只会显示源码或下载文件,不会执行。
在C++中,结构体(struct)默认不支持直接比较操作(如 ==、!=、< 等),因为编译器不知道如何判断两个结构体是否“相等”或“谁小”。
但反射绕过了编译时的类型检查,容易破坏类型安全,增加出错风险。
GobEncoder接口的文档指出,实现该接口的类型可以“完全控制其数据的表示形式,因此可以包含私有字段、通道和函数等通常无法在gob流中传输的内容”。
1. 为什么选择 FluentValidation?
本文链接:http://www.komputia.com/860511_996c95.html